Celebrate the Fourth At This New Belmont Eatery

The Wellington Belmont

Four seems to be the lucky number of chef Dante de Magistris, who opened his (you guessed it) fourth restaurant in Belmont — The Wellington Neighborhood Eatery. Along with his two brothers, Damian and Filippo, de Magistris is already the owner of Restaurant dante, il Casale Lexington and il Casale Belmont. The new spot strays from its sisters as far as cuisine goes, saying arrivederci to Italian-American eats and ciao to all-American entrees. Stop by 75 Leonard Street in Belmont on the Fourth of July for a plethora of plates like Steak Tots (pan roasted flat iron steak, green peppercorn pan sauce, green garlic butter, tarragon, truffle dressed cress), The Wellington Burger (puff pastry in between two flat patties, truffle mushroom duxelles, braised spinach, caramelized onions), or the Fried Chicken (dry chili honey glaze or simply honey glaze, buttermilk ranch, shaved cucumber radish salad, mint, cilantro).
